Mascot NSW 2020 Australia is a suburb located in the city of Sydney, New South Wales. It is situated approximately 7 kilometers south of the Sydney central business district. Mascot is part of the Bayside Council local government area. The suburb of Mascot is best known for being the location of the Sydney Airport, which is the main international and domestic airport in the city. The airport brings a significant amount of tourism and business to the area, making Mascot a hub for travelers and commuters. In recent years, Mascot has experienced considerable growth and development. It has become an increasingly popular residential area for young professionals and families due to its close proximity to the city center and transportation links. There has been an increase in the construction of high-rise apartment buildings and townhouses, catering to the demand for modern and convenient living.

Mascot also offers a range of amenities and facilities for its residents. There are several parks and recreational areas, including Mascot Memorial Park and Mascot Oval, providing opportunities for outdoor activities and sports. The suburb is also home to various schools, shopping centers, and restaurants, ensuring that residents have access to essential services and entertainment options. Transportation in Mascot is highly accessible. Apart from the Sydney Airport, there are several train stations, including Mascot Station and Domestic Airport Station, which provide easy access to the city and other Sydney suburbs. Additionally, there are bus services that connect Mascot to different areas within the city.
